The STIHL RT 5097 C ride-on mower will effortlessly mow large lawns up to 6000m² in size. With its high degree of driving comfort and the clearly arranged controls, this ride-on mower offers well thought out features for effortless mowing. To achieve the most comfortable working position you can easily adjust the spring-loaded seat without the use of tools. Thanks to the simple cutting height adjustment and the electromagnetic blade clutch for activating and deactivating the mowing deck, you achieve high mowing performance and a top-quality finish. The catching management system on both sides of the mowing deck gathers the grass across the entire cutting width and guides it towards the cutting blades. The comfortable single pedal drive allows you to manoeuvre the mower precisely, giving you full control, perfect for lawns with flower beds and shrubs. You can change the driving direction of the lawn tractor from forward to reverse gear with a single action. Thanks to the practical curve shaped handle, the 250-litre grass catcher box can be emptied effortlessly from the driver's seat. And, the polymer grass catcher box is very easy to clean. 

Standard features


  • Turf tyres

    The large turf tyres of the STIHL ride-on mower help to protect the lawn. Thanks to their rounded tyre design, they reduce the formation of driving tracks.

  • Trailer hitch

    The integral trailer hitch enables easy mounting of attachments such as the convenient PICK UP 300 tilting trailer, which can also be used as a wheel barrow.

  • Central cutting height adjustment

    The lever to adjust the deck cutting height is located directly next to the driver's seat. It enables individual adjustment of the cutting height in up to eight steps.

  • Robust frame

    The robust frame construction gives the mower a high level of stability and driving comfort. The STIHL ride-on mowers compact design is great for using attachments such as the AGW 098 garden roller or PICK 300 tilting trailer.

  • Spring-loaded and adjustable seat

    The most comfortable seat position can be set without the use of tools. This allows individual adjustment of the driver's seat to almost any body size.

  • Low step

    The low step on the STIHL ride-on mowers provides ample legroom and allows for comfortable access to the seat.

  • Catching management system

    The catching system guides the grass blades across the entire working width of the mowing deck. It helps to guide the grass towards the mowing blades for a more efficient cut.

  • Grass catcher box with bow handle

    The polymer grass catcher box can be emptied effortlessly from the driver’s seat simply using the curved shaped handle. The "dumper" design ensures optimum filling and residual-free emptying of the grass catcher box. Cleaning the catcher box is also easy.

  • Single pedal drive

    With the STIHL single pedal drive, the direction of travel can be conveniently switched between forward and reverse gear using a hand lever for quick manoeuvring. The pressure-sensitive pedal allows for precise control of the speed between top speed and standstill. The separate brake pedal ensures immediate stopping.

  • Electromagnetic blade clutch (EBC)

    The mowing deck can be easily engaged and disengaged by a switch situated on the control panel.


Additional features

  • Mulching function

    With the mulch insert, the STIHL ride-on mowers can be converted into mulching mowers. The grass catcher box is simply removed and the mulch insert pushed into the grass catcher chute. This allows the grass to be shredded into fine particles inside the closed housing before they fall back into the turf, returning vital nutrients and moisture to the soil. Through this natural form of fertilising, there is no need to dispose of the grass.

One of the earliest books in Christianity, The Shepherd of Hermas was probably written around 140AD, and avidly read for the first few hundred years. Likely its failure to become one of the recognized books of the Canon (Bible) had something to do with its fall-off in popularity. Today, while an Apocryphal book from the age of Apostolic Fathers, it seems arcane, and somewhat desultory. Nevertheless, one can see this book as a vision, a dream, or even an attempt to describe elements of purgatory. Both Latin and Greek copies, at least in part have been found, there are also parts missing which make reading it a bit of a challenge. At times it has been somewhat repetitive and tedious to read. I read the edition and translation from the Greek by Bart D. Ehrman: "The Apostolic Fathers Vol. II" from the Loeb Classical Library. The original author was claimed by some to be the brother of Pope Pius I. It is interesting to have a view into what the Council Fathers were looking at when deciding what to add to the Canon, and what not to add.
